I find an Arai shell purrfect!
Some people prefer the Shoei fit or maybe AGV, so I would say if it feels snug and cumfy get it!
As for the safety issue most reasonable priced helmets are as safe as each other and a hell of a lot of professional racers swear by Arai.
I would ignore the test findings cuz they are often biased and go for the best fit.
Arai also offer free servicing, interchangeable cheek pads if you want it a bit tighter or it gives a bit, removable liner for cleaning and easy change readily available visors.
3 Rules:
Fit
Fit
and Fit
Then style and budget!
The Arai Viper is in my opinion even more snug than the dearer Corsair (although marginally heavier it is quieter too), its a bit more like the Corsair's predecessor the RX7RR.
Make sure its very snug all over your head and almost tight on your cheeks, so when you open your mouth and close it again you almost bite the inside of them, it will give!
